... Read moreHaving tried various workout routines myself, I found that dedicating just one hour a day to focused exercise at home can significantly improve energy levels and overall fitness. These short sessions are perfect for anyone juggling a busy life because they fit easily between other commitments. I usually start with a 5-minute warm-up like jumping jacks or dynamic stretches to get my blood flowing. Then I move on to a mix of bodyweight exercises such as squats, push-ups, lunges, and planks. What I love about this approach is that it requires no equipment, so setup time is zero, making it even easier to stay consistent. Incorporating interval training adds intensity, boosting calorie burn efficiently. For example, I alternate 30 seconds of high-intensity movements like burpees with 30 seconds of rest or low-intensity activities. This method not only challenges the body but also keeps the session engaging. Another tip is to listen to your body and modify exercises as needed to suit your fitness level. If you’re just starting out, doing fewer reps or slower movements works perfectly and still delivers benefits. Lastly, I add a cool-down phase to prevent muscle soreness and improve flexibility, often including gentle stretches targeting major muscle groups. These simple at-home workouts are easy to adapt and can make a huge difference in achieving your fitness goals without the hassle of a gym visit.
